The Opportunity:Avantor is looking for a strategic Manager, Avantor Business System to join our organization, supporting the roll out of design, adoption, and execution of the ABS across select business segments within our manufacturing and distribution centers.The Manager, Avantor Business System will focus on creating, supporting, and assisting the improvement efforts tied to the company's most critical business processes, primarily in the innovation, commercial, and operations functions. Through analyzing processes, diagnosing operational challenges, and implementing process changes, in this role you will drive continuous improvement and breakthrough performance ultimately shaping company culture and brand.This position is full-time, remote (preferably in EST / CST time zones) plus approximately 80% travel (2 weeks per month) to assigned manufacturing and distribution centers.What we're looking forEducation: BS or BA Degree (ideally Industrial Engineering, Systems Engineering, Manufacturing Engineering); Master's Degree preferredExperience: Minimum 5 years in a lean/operational leadership roleExtensive training and implementation experience in industry leading lean tools and practices (Kaizen, Gemba)Ability to accurately assess key business metrics and situations from a general manager's perspective.Familiarity with various manufacturing process technologiesExcellent time and project managementExecution - Delivers and measures results.Influence - Drive commitment over compliance, must be able to inform, convince, and persuade others to take action on initiatives.Technical Expertise - Possess the technical skills necessary to be credible; must have significant practitioner experience in Growth & Lean tools and processes.Communication - must be able to effectively communicate in both written and verbal forms, and courageously speak to all levels of the organization.Demonstrated successful leadership and proficiency in building and implementing lean business system/practices for global manufacturing organization (in a variety of situations)Strategic mindset with hands-on approachStrong focus on customer and end user experienceGains traction quickly, demonstrates ambition and high energy.Independent worker, capable of operating in a fast-moving, ever-changing environment and able to effectively deal with difficult situations.How you will thrive and create an impactDeploy Avantor Business System and organization through partnership and influence of the Executive Leadership TeamImplement the Business System including daily management metrics, review and problem-solving cadence and agenda/format, process to address KPI and CVD (core value drivers); implementing lean tools and training programs to enable PSP/action planning.Establish a lean deployment program which; ensures the application of globally recognized standards for lean principles and practices, serves as a benchmark for Avantor's achievements, provides a common roadmap for continuous improvement and workforce development.Develop capability across the spectrum from the tactical (deployment and application of principles, concepts, and methods) to the strategic (a transformation that deeply impacts a key value stream)Coaching and implementation of best-in-class lean tools and methodology (hands-on experience a must)Disclaimer:
